INTRODUCTION
The enclosed resolutions authorize the public bidding procedure for the Timber
Ridge/Rustic Point Water Main Extension 2017 Project.
BACKGROUND
By Resolution 69-17 on February 20, 2017, City Council adopted a resolution of
necessity, directing staff to create an Urban Renewal Plan (Plan) for the Derby Grange
Road Housing Urban Renewal Area (Area), creating a tax increment finance district
including the districts of Rustic Point Estates and Timber Ridge Estates. The Plan related
to housing and residential development was reviewed by the Long-Range Planning
Advisory Commission on March 15, 2017. The City Council received the Long-Range
Planning Advisory Commission recommendation affirming that the Plan is consistent with
the City's Comprehensive Plan for development. The Comprehensive Plan calls for the
support of an adequate and cost-effective water supply that meets local, state, and
federal water quality standards. The creation of the Derby Grange Housing Urban
Renewal Area will allow for the use of tax increment to cover reimbursable costs
associated with the installation water infrastructure in the Area.
DISCUSSION
This project will provide for the installation of 7500 LF of 12" DR-14 Water Main along JFK
Road to serve the area along JFK Road and the Derby Grange Road Housing Urban
Renewal Area. The installation will occur along the west side of JFK Road from near
Grandview United Methodist Church up to the proposed Timber Ridge Estates sub-
division across from Forest Glen Court. This project also includes extending 12" DR-14
water main along Derby Grange Road along the north side from JFK Road to near the
entrance to the Derby Grange Golf facility.
The construction of the improvements will include:
— Installation of approximately 7500 feet of DR-14 water main
- Excavation of the subgrade to allow the placement of bedding stone and proper
backfill for the water main.
- Removal of asphalt pavement and replacement as required at street crossings and
along Derby Grange Road and JFK Road.
- Installation of 12 fire hydrants.
The project construction documents will follow the Statewide Urban Design and
Specifications (SODAS) and 2012 City of Dubuque Water Main specifications in the
development of the construction documents.
The Iowa Department of Natural Resources (IDNR) will be consulted on all permitting
required.
A work in the right of way permit for Dubuque County will be submitted for approval with
the Dubuque County Secondary Roads Department. The project will be subject to
Dubuque County Board of Supervisors approval.

BUDGETIMPACT
The estimate of probable cost for the JFK Water Main Extension 2017 Project is as
follows:
Estimate
Construction Contract $ 822,000.00
Contingency (10%) 82,200.00
Construction Engineering & Inspection 20,000.00
Total Project Cost $924,200.00

120.1 Time and Place for Filing Sealed Proposals
Sealed Bids for the work comprising each improvement as stated below must be filed
before 2:00 p.m. on May 18, 2017, in the Office of the City Clerk, City Hall - First Floor,
50 West 13`h Street, Dubuque, Iowa.
120.2 Time and Placed Sealed Proposals Will be Opened and Considered
Sealed proposals will be opened and Bids tabulated at 2:00p.m. on May 18, 2017, at
City Hall - Conference Room B, 50 West 13`h Street, Dubuque, Iowa, for consideration
by the City Council at its meeting on June 5, 2017. The City of Dubuque, Iowa, reserves
the right to reject any and all Bids.
120.3 Time for Commencement and Completion of Work
Work on the Project must be commenced within ten (10) calendar days after the Notice
to Proceed has been issued and shall be fully completed by August 1, 2017.
120.4 Bid Security
Each Bidder must accompany its Bid with a Bid security as security that the successful
Bidder will enter into a contract for the work Bid upon and will furnish after the award of
contract a corporate surety Bond, acceptable to the governmental entity, for the faithful
performance of the contract, in an amount equal to one hundred percent of the amount
of the contract. The Bid security must be in the amount of ten percent (10%) of the
amount of the contract and must be in the form of a cashier's check or certified check
drawn on a state-chartered or federally chartered bank, or a certified share draft drawn
on a state-chartered or federally chartered credit union, or the Bidder may provide a Bid
Bond with corporate surety satisfactory to the governmental entity. The Bid Bond must
contain no conditions except as provided in this section.
120.5 Contract Documents
Copies of the Contract Documents may be obtained at the Engineering Department, City
Hall — Second Floor, 50 West 13`h Street, Dubuque, Iowa 52001. The Contract
Documents will also be available on the City's website at
www.citvofdubuque.org/bids.aspx. No plan deposit is required.
120.6 Preference for Iowa Products and Labor
By virtue of statutory authority, preference will be given to products and provisions grown
and coal produced within the State of Iowa, and to Iowa domestic labor, to the extent
lawfully required under Iowa statutes.
120.7 Sales Tax
The Bidder should not include State of Iowa sales tax in its Bid. A sales tax exemption
certificate will be available for all material purchased in Iowa for incorporation into the
Project.
